Put a copy of Librespeed on a web server that's accessible through the VPN and told them to use that. For (our) convenience, it's logged into a database that's correlated with the VPN login/logout times so the users don't even need to log in to use it, but we still know whose test result it is. Go to webex.com and login. On the left side menu, choose Preferences (gear icon) and then choose Audio and Video from the tab menu. Under Audio Connection there is a section for Entry and exit tone. Make sure that is set to Beep. Source: over 3 years ago
